MLB | Helling calls it quits after 12 years

The Associated Press is reporting free-agent P Rick Helling (Brewers) is retiring from baseball after pitching in the major leagues for 12 years, highlighted by a 20-win season. "I've said all along that I would retire if I couldn't do it anymore or if I couldn't be away from my family anymore," Helling said. "I couldn't handle being away from my family." Helling was 93-81 with a 4.68 ERA for five different teams. His best season was 1998, when he went 20-7 for the Texas Rangers.
